Setting the Time Correction Adjustment Unit (TCR Parameter) The unit of measurement for time correction can be set as either "cm" or "inch." (Initial setting: "cm") 1 Press [FUNC.]. 2 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select "Sound Field Adj.," and then press the [Rotary encoder]. 3 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select "Setup," and then press the [Rotary encoder]. 4 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select "TCR Parameter," and then press the [Rotary encoder]. Setting the Time Correction Adjustment
Unit (TCR Parameter)
The unit of measurement for time correction can be set as either “cm” or
“inch.” (Initial setting: “cm”)
1
Press [FUNC.].
2
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select “Sound Field
Adj.,” and then press the [Rotary encoder].
3
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select “Setup,” and
then press the [Rotary encoder].
4
Rotate the [Rotary encoder] to select “TCR
Parameter,” and then press the [Rotary encoder].
5
Select either “cm” or “inch” by rotating the [Rotary
encoder], and press the [Rotary encoder].
cm:
The unit for the time correction becomes “cm.”
inch: The unit for the time correction becomes “inch.”
6
When the setting is complete, press and hold [
]
for at least 2 seconds.
If [
] is pressed during setting, the unit returns to the previous
item.
